What Is the EB-5 Visa?

Understanding the EB-5 Visa is essential for foreign financiers seeking permanent residency in the United States. Developed by the Immigration Act of 1990, the EB-5 Visa program uses a pathway to legal long-term residency for people that buy a united state business. This program is specifically appealing as it allows financiers and their immediate household participants-- partners and unmarried youngsters under 21-- to get Visa, promoting their transfer to the united state

To get the EB-5 Visa, capitalists should make a minimal financial investment in a brand-new or existing company. This financial investment has to preserve or develop a minimum of 10 full time jobs for united state workers. The financial investment can be made straight in a business or with a marked Regional Facility, which is a company accepted by united state Citizenship and Immigration Provider (USCIS) to promote financial development with work creation.

Step-by-Step Application Process

Steering the application procedure for the EB-5 Visa investment program requires cautious planning and interest to information. The trip starts with selecting an ideal investment chance, ideally with a Regional Center, to ensure conformity with program needs. Conduct thorough due diligence to analyze the task's stability and task creation capacity.

When you've made your financial investment, the next step is to prepare Kind I-526, Immigrant Request by Alien Investor. This kind calls for supporting documentation, including proof of your financial investment funds' authorized source and a substantial organization strategy detailing job development metrics.

After the USCIS procedures Type I-526 and accepts it, you can move on with either readjusting your standing if already in the united state or looking for an immigrant visa at an U.S. consular office abroad. You will require to send Form DS-260, Immigrant Visa and Alien Enrollment Application, in addition to medical exams and various other needed files

Regional Centers vs. Direct Investment

Picking in between local facilities and direct investment is an essential choice for prospective EB-5 financiers. The EB-5 Immigrant Financier Program supplies 2 key pathways to accomplish permanent residency: spending through a local center or making a direct financial investment into a qualifying service.

Regional centers are marked companies that handle particular EB-5 financial investment tasks. They commonly pool funds from several investors to fund larger tasks, such as real estate advancements or facilities efforts. This option usually permits capitalists to gain from a much more passive financial investment approach, as regional facilities take care of project management and work creation demands in behalf of the capitalists.

In contrast, straight financial investment entails the financier actively taking care of a new or existing service, consequently straight controlling their investment. This course may appeal to those with business experience or a wish to engage very closely with their service operations. Nonetheless, it calls for a more hands-on strategy, including meeting particular job creation standards directly tied to the capitalist's business.

Ultimately, the choice between local centers and direct financial investment relies on an investor's monetary objectives, risk resistance, and involvement degree in business venture. Mindful consideration of these aspects is essential for an effective EB-5 investment experience.

How much time Does the EB-5 Visa Process Normally Take?


The EB-5 visa procedure generally takes 18 to 24 months from application submission to authorization. Processing times might vary based on private situations, USCIS workload, and local center project specifics, possibly prolonging the timeline.

Can Family Members Apply With the Primary Financier?

Yes, member of the family can use along with the main investor under the EB-5 visa program. Immediate loved ones, including partners and single kids under 21, are eligible for acquired visas, promoting their residency in the United States.
